Whether it’s getting hurt, losing a big game, dealing with an off-season injury, having to work through the difficult process of building a winning team, or being in a slump, all athletes must find ways to deal with and learn from adversity.
Resilience is a key component of success in sport, life, and other areas. The ability to rise above and overcome adversity allows people to be stronger, wiser, and more confident. Fortunately, most elite athletes possess the natural ability to develop resilience through the use of multiple personal (searching for meaning, positive outlook and reflection) and situational (social support, access to sport, physical and informational resources) coping strategies.
However, many younger athletes do not know how to apply these skills and struggle when adversity strikes. This is where coaching, mentorship and other supportive mechanisms can help.

The most important thing to remember during adversity is to focus on what you can control. Putting energy into factors that you cannot control will drain and deplete your resources. Be sure to define what you can control early on and pour all of your resources into those areas. For example, if bad officiating is distracting you, try to refocus your attention on the things you can control, such as your effort and consistency. It’s also helpful to practice mindfulness and meditation practices, which can help to reduce stress and increase mental calmness.
